This year there are four nests, perhaps the beginning of a nesting colony. I couldn’t get all the nests in one photo but here are three of them. The tall tree on the right has one nest near the top and one nest about halfway down. Another nest is at the top of the dead tree on the left (two birds are in the nest). I got this series of photos showing one of the herons doing a breeding display. This move is described as follows in Birds of North America. “The Stretch display is when an unpaired male extends his neck, raises his bill toward the vertical, and erects his neck plumes while exhibiting his bright soft parts. His neck is then retracted, accompanied by a moaning Gooo call.”
